Title:
MANUFACTURE OF PERMANENT MAGNET

Abstract:

PURPOSE: To produce a thin shaped magnet with good yield by a method wherein rare earth-Fe-B system alloy is refined and powdered, that is, fine grinding is performed after rough grinding, the material is subjected to compression forming in magnetic field and hot extruction process is performed after canning.

CONSTITUTION: An ingot, which is the refined alloy of composition showed by the formula, is subjected to rough grinding by stamping mill and jet mill, then is subjected to fine grinding by jet mill. Thereafter, the said powder is subjected to compression forming in magnet field and canning is performed to a forming body using a can made by iron. In this formula, R means Nd only or combination of Nd and one or more than 2 of the othe rare earth element, and M means combination of one or more than 2 of Al, V, P, W, Ti, Ni, Nb, Cr, Mo, Si, Zr, Hf, Mn, Bi, and Sn and Sb. 0≤X≤0.5, 0.02≤Y≤0.3, 0≤Z≤0.03, 4≤A≤7.5. Consequently, hot extrusion process is performed at within the temperature of 600W 1,150°C and extrusion ratio of 3W20. Thus, a thin shaped magnet can be produced with good yield.
